**Q: The library catalogue import for Shelfwright stalled at the deduplication stage — what now?**

A: This usually means the incoming MARC batch from the Copperfield branch contains malformed record headers. Do not retry the import, as partial duplicates may persist. Instead, quarantine the batch, note the import run timestamp, and send both details to the catalogue team inbox below.

escalation mailbox, hadug-bajog: sormir@norvalabs.internal

Subject: Quickstore 4.2 — bloom filter now fronts the KV layer

Plugin authors: starting with this release, Quickstore places a bloom filter ahead of the key-value store. Negative lookups return faster; false positives fall through safely. No API changes are required on your side. Verify your plugin against the staging build referenced below.

session token of fahif-tadup = htk3_9c7

14:02 — Pricing update pushed to the Orchardline product catalog.
14:05 — Storefront continued serving stale prices; invalidation events silently dropped.
14:18 — On-call engineer Mira traced the drop to a queue consumer that deserialized the new event schema incorrectly and discarded messages.
14:40 — Consumer rolled back; full cache flush issued.
15:10 — Prices consistent across regions.

Future maintainers: the schema mismatch originated in the consumer build referenced below.

session token of yajof-bagef = htk4_937d